首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在pandas数据框中添加边框到html表行标题?

在pandas数据框中添加边框到HTML表行标题可以通过使用CSS样式来实现。具体步骤如下:

  1. 首先,需要将pandas数据框转换为HTML表格。可以使用to_html()方法将数据框转换为HTML格式的表格。
  2. 在转换为HTML表格之前,可以通过设置DataFrame.style属性来自定义样式。使用set_table_styles()方法可以为表格添加CSS样式。
  3. 在CSS样式中,可以使用th选择器来选择表格的行标题。通过设置border属性可以为行标题添加边框。

下面是一个示例代码:

代码语言:txt
复制
import pandas as pd

# 创建一个示例数据框
data = {'Name': ['John', 'Emma', 'Peter'],
        'Age': [25, 28, 30],
        'City': ['New York', 'London', 'Paris']}
df = pd.DataFrame(data)

# 将数据框转换为HTML表格
html_table = df.to_html(index=False)

# 添加CSS样式
css_styles = [{'selector': 'th', 'props': [('border', '1px solid black')]}]
styled_table = df.style.set_table_styles(css_styles).hide_index()

# 将带有样式的表格转换为HTML格式
html_with_styles = styled_table.render()

# 打印HTML表格
print(html_with_styles)

在上述示例中,我们创建了一个示例数据框df,然后将其转换为HTML表格html_table。接下来,我们定义了一个CSS样式css_styles,其中选择器为th,并设置了border属性为1px solid black,即为行标题添加了边框。然后,我们使用set_table_styles()方法将样式应用于数据框,并使用hide_index()方法隐藏了行索引。最后,我们使用render()方法将带有样式的表格转换为HTML格式,并将其打印出来。

这样,我们就可以在pandas数据框的HTML表格中添加边框到行标题了。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云原生应用引擎 TKE:https://cloud.tencent.com/product/tke
  • 人工智能平台 PAI:https://cloud.tencent.com/product/pai
  • 物联网平台 IoT Hub:https://cloud.tencent.com/product/iothub
  • 移动开发平台 MDP:https://cloud.tencent.com/product/mdp
  • 云存储 COS:https://cloud.tencent.com/product/cos
  • 区块链服务 BaaS: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

03.HTML头部CSS图像表格列表

元素: 定义了浏览器工具栏的标题 当网页添加到收藏夹时,显示在收藏夹标题 显示在搜索引擎结果页面的标题 一个简单的 HTML 文档: 实例 HTML 元素 ...在 元素你也可以直接添加样式来渲染 HTML 文档: HTML 元素 meta标签描述了一些基本的元数据。...CSS 可以通过以下方式添加HTML: 内联样式- 在HTML元素中使用"style" 属性 内部样式 -在HTML文档头部 区域使用 元素 来包含CSS 外部引用 -...从不同的位置插入图片 本例演示如何将其他文件夹或服务器的图片显示网页HTML 图像- 图像标签( )和源属性(Src) 在 HTML ,图像由 标签定义。...Jill Smith 50 Eve Jackson 94 John Doe 80 Adam Johnson 67 表格 这个例子演示如何在 HTML 文档创建表格。

19.4K101
  • excel常用操作大全

    在EXCEL菜单,单击文件-页面设置-工作-打印标题;您可以通过按下折叠对话的按钮并用鼠标划定范围,将标题设置在顶端或左端。这样,Excel会自动将您指定的部分添加为每页的页眉。...这个问题应该解决如下:第一,在EXCEL菜单"文件"-页面设置-工作-打印标题;您可以设置顶部标题,选择工资单的标题,选择菜单插入-每行之间的分页符,并将页面长度设置为工资单的高度。...19.如何在表单添加斜线? 一般来说,我们习惯在表单上使用斜线,但是工作本身不提供这个功能。事实上,我们可以使用绘图工具来实现: 点击“绘图”按钮,选择“直线”,鼠标将变成一个十字。...将它移动到您想要添加斜线,的开始位置,按住鼠标左键并将其拖动到结束位置,释放鼠标,将绘制斜线。此外,您可以使用“文本”按钮轻松地在斜线的顶部和底部添加文本,但是文本周围有边框。...当我们在工作输入数据时,我们有时会在向下滚动时记住每个列标题的相对位置,尤其是当标题消失时。此时,您可以将窗口分成几个部分,然后将标题部分保留在屏幕上,只滚动数据部分。

    19.2K10

    用Python自动生成Excel数据报表!

    一共是有1000的销售数据。 使用xlwings库创建一个Excel工作簿,在工作簿创建一个名为fruit_and_veg_sales,然后将原始数据复制进去。...fruit_and_veg_sales有我们的数据,Dashboard则是空白的。 下面使用pandas来处理数据,生成Dashboard数据信息。...DashBoard的头两个表格,一个是产品的利润表格,一个是产品的销售数量表格。 使用到了pandas数据透视函数。...稍后会将数据放置Excel的中去。 下面对月份进行分组汇总,得出每个月的销售情况。...可以看到,一数据经过Python的处理,变为一目了然的表格。 最后再绘制一个matplotlib图表,添加一张logo图片,并保存Excel文件。

    2K10

    Java学习笔记-全栈-web开发-01-HTML基础总览

    : ? 1.4.3 空的Html标签 没有内容的 HTML 元素被称为空元素。空元素是在开始标签关闭的。 就是没有关闭标签的空元素( 标签定义换行)。...在开始标签添加斜杠,比如 ,是关闭空元素的正确方法。 即使 在所有浏览器中都是有效的,但使用 其实是更长远的保障。...它代表的是标题 2.1.4 body标签 的内容会被显示。...Html绝大多数元素被定义为块级元素或内联元素。 块级元素在浏览器显示时,通常会以新来开始。例如 div p等 内联元素在浏览器显示时,通常不会以新来开始。...2.3.1 p标签 标签是段落标签,可以将html文档分割为若干段落。浏览器会自动在段落前后添加空行。

    2.6K20

    「毕业设计」调教Word指南

    另存为 标题添加“下划线” 其实我们是添加一个下边框来达到下划线的效果,效果如下图所示。 插入大小一致的图片 原理:通过表格来限制图片的大小。...标题添加“下划线” 表格整理图片 插入后的表格如图所示,最后记得把表格的边框全部隐藏。...套用样式 图标公式及编号 三线设置 在将格式应用于中将样式分别调整为标题、汇总行的样式依次进行设置。...三线设计 调整完成之后记得将表格样式保存为一个样式,这样后续我们就可以对其他表格应用其样式。 如何在表格插入标题?首先选中表格,然后在引用菜单,选择插入题注命令。...表格设置为3列4,选中表格,对所有边框进行隐藏,然后对最后一列显示下边框与内部边框。 ----- END -----

    1.8K10

    HTML+CSS基础精通系统学习

    2.5:…标签标记 HTML 文档的开始和结束 2.6:标题标签(H1 H6 标签用于指定不同级别的标题) 跨多行的表格 : rowspan =“n” 属性表示跨多少?...设置对其方式: align属性用来设置表格、、列的对齐方式 填充属性、间距属性: border(边框的厚度) cellpadding(单元格填充)用来设置表格内填充距离 cellspacing...在浏览器创建左右结构的窗口: border="5";窗口边框的宽度 使用框架: 创建多个复杂的窗口实现步骤如下: 1、创建1个HTML...开 头; 2、在HTML中使用样式时,使用ID选择器需要id属性;使用CLASS选择 器需要class属性; 3、HTML标签的id属性,通常用于唯一的标识页面的一个页面元素,

    3.2K50

    HTML+CSS纯干货就业前基础精通系统学习201693

    2.5:…标签标记 HTML 文档的开始和结束 2.6:标题标签(H1 H6 标签用于指定不同级别的标题) ...--border用来设置表格边框尺寸大小,tr定义行,td定义列,table定义表格--> 跨多行的表格 : rowspan =“n” 属性表示跨多少?...border用来设置表格边框尺寸大小 bordercolor用来设置表格边框颜色 设置背景: background属性用来设置表格的背景图片 bgcolor属性用来设置表格、、列的背景色。...在浏览器创建左右结构的窗口: border="5";窗口边框的宽度 使用框架: 创建多个复杂的窗口实现步骤如下: 1、创建1个HTML页面“top.html...开 头; 2、在HTML中使用样式时,使用ID选择器需要id属性;使用CLASS选择 器需要class属性; 3、HTML标签的id属性,通常用于唯一的标识页面的一个页面元素, 不允许重复;class

    4.1K90

    前端开发学习──初识Html

    标题标签 主体标签 html标签 单标签 注释标签 水平线标签 换行标签 双标签 段落标签...文本内容,特点:上下自动生成空白,而标签换行不会生成空白 标题标签,h1-h6 取值h6,建议h1标签在一个页面里只能出现一次 文本标签 文本内容...每个表格均有若干(由 标签定义),每行被分割为若干单元格(由 标签定义)。字母 td 指表格数据(table data),即数据单元格的内容。...td内容居中 bgcolor=”yellow” 背景颜色 bordercolor="red" 边框颜色 表头 标题 单元格合并:colspan=”2”...html特殊字符 ? 特殊字符 标签语义化 好的语义化的网站标准就是去掉样式文件之后,结构依然很清晰。

    1.8K20

    Web前端上万字的知识总结

    1、和 标签限定了文档的开始和结束点。   ...Left:左对齐(默认)     Right:右对齐     Center:居中     Class:用一个名称来标记标题,标记名称指向在外部定义的样式     Id:为段落设置一个标记,将来可以在一个超链接明确的引用这个标记...,以便作为样式的选择器     Style:创建标题内容的内联样式     Title:给标题加上一个说明性的文字   (2)、标记普通字   属性:     Face:字体      ...      none不显示内部边框            rows仅显示边框   (2)、定义行     属性:dir       lang        class        id   ...重新定义标签样式表语法:                 exp:        td{color:red;font-size:8pt}     (b)、类样式:能够在文档样式或外部样式为同一个元素创建不同的样式

    3.7K100

    BootStrap基础知识

    使用来创建水平的列组。 内容需要放置在列,并且只有列可以是的直接子节点。 预定义的类 .row 和 .col-* 可用于快速制作栅格布局。 列通过填充创建列内容之间的间隙。...提示在链接的标签上添加 alert-link 类来设置匹配提示颜色的链接 可以在提示的 div 添加 .alert-dismissible 类,然后在关闭按钮的链接上添加 class="close... 元素上添加 .dropdown-menu 类来设置实际下拉式功能,然后在下拉式功能的选项添加 .dropdown-item 类。...可以在 标签中使用 dropdown-divider 类用于在下拉式功能创建一个水平的分割线 dropdown-header 类用于在下拉式功能添加标题 active 类会让下拉式功能的选项高亮显示...,它在鼠标点击元素后显示,与提示不同的是它可以显示更多的内容。

    28310

    HTML基础入门

    负责对网页语法的解释(标准通用标记语言下的一个应用HTML、JavaScript),并渲染网页   内核分类:   Trident:IE,猎豹安全浏览器,360极速浏览器,百度浏览器   Gecko:...--注释内容-->:HTML注释,给代码添加的代码说明性的文字,或者使一些没有必要去掉它的作用 语义化:是指用合理HTML标签以及特有的属性去格式化文档内容   三、HTML标签   1,基本标签 不加标签的纯文字也是可以在...body写的 加粗 斜体 下划线 删除 段落标签 #独占一个段落 标题1 标题2 标题...cellpadding 表格的单元格的内容跟边框的距离 align 水平位置,left center right--> 帅哥排行</...--table 表格 tr td 行内的单元格 th 表头 caption 标题 thead 容纳的表头 tbody 容纳的主体内容

    1.3K42

    HTML5 与CSS3 相关笔记

    18.表格基本结构:单元格、、列 (1),,, (2)HTML5已废除table的border属性,用css控制边框宽度。...(3)按钮:button普通(要和事件onclick关联使用),submit(提交表单action指定的url并传递表单数据),reset重置。...57.总结如何用transition实现过渡动画: (1)在默认样式声明元素的初始状态。 (2)声明过渡元素之中状态样式,悬浮状态 (3)在默认样式通过添加过渡函数,添加不同的样式。...5、:表格的一个单元格,一包含几对这行中就有几个单元格。 6、表格列的个数,取决于一数据单元格的个数。...即连续的 会在同一内显示。即使有多个 ,浏览器也不会把它们回车拆。 2.段落间距、换行 3.用JS动态给HTML添加空格: 例为照顾CSS样式或照顾特殊效果的实现。

    5.4K30

    三峡大学复杂数据预处理day01-day03

    第1天 下午 1、数据采集 第2天 上午 1、基于selenium实现浏览器自动化采集数据 第2天 下午 1、Python实现疫情数据爬取 第3天 上午 1、Pandas实现疫情数据探索性分析...,包含标题和页面元信息 :身体部分,显示页面内容的标签 《一》常用标签: - :定义html标题,由h1~h6组成, 定义最大的标题。...通常存储在外部样式,即CSS 文件 ,外部样式可以极大提高工作效率。...颜色的名称 - : red 对齐方式 :文本排列属性是用来设置文本的水平对齐方式,文本可居中或对齐左或右,两端对齐....可以设置的颜色:name - 指定颜色的名称, "red";RGB - 指定 RGB 值, "rgb(252,450,9)";Hex - 指定16进制值, "#ff0000" 可以在一个属性设置边框

    21640

    Python替代Excel Vba系列(三):pandas处理不规范数据

    但是身经百战的你肯定会觉得,前2篇例子数据太规范了,如果把数据导入数据库还是可以方便解决问题的。 因此,本文将使用稍微复杂的数据做演示,充分说明 pandas 是如何灵活处理各种数据。...---- 案例 这次的数据是一个教师课程。如下图: 其中表格的第3是班级。诸如"一1",表示是一年级1班,最多8个年级。 表格的1至3列,分别表示"星期"、"上下午"、"第几节课"。...如下是一个 DataFrame 的组成部分: 红框的是 DataFrame 的值部分(values) 上方深蓝色是 DataFrame 的列索引(columns),注意,为什么方框不是一?...左方深蓝色是 DataFrame 的索引(index)。本质上是与列索引一致,只是 index 用于定位,columns 用于定位列。...---- 数据如下: ---- ---- 最后 本文通过实例展示了如何在 Python 中使用 xlwings + pandas 灵活处理各种的不规范格式表格数据

    5K30
    领券